Importance of Infant Pearly Whites Care



You need to focus on cleaning and flossing to preserve the general health of your child's baby teeth. Baby teeth play a crucial role in your child's dental growth. They help your child eat, talk, and smile correctly.



Ignoring the treatment of baby teeth can bring about different dental health concerns, such as dental cavity and periodontal disease. Brushing twice a day with a fluoride tooth paste helps eliminate plaque and microorganisms that can create cavities. Flossing once a day is just as vital to clean up the locations between the teeth that a tooth brush can't get to.

Tips for Avoiding Dental Cavity in Baby Pearly Whites



To stop tooth decay in your kid's primary teeth, adhere to these basic suggestions.

- First, make sure to clean your kid's teeth two times a day making use of a soft-bristled toothbrush and a pea-sized amount of fluoride toothpaste. Urge them to spit out the toothpaste instead of swallowing it.

- Stay clear of putting your child to bed with a container or sippy cup filled with sweet liquids, as this can lead to tooth decay.

- Finally, schedule routine dental check-ups for your child, beginning with the age of one year.
